Darkinjung

The Darkinjung (not to be confused with the Darkinyung people further inland) are the Local Aboriginal Land Council in the Central Coast, New South Wales, area of Australia and a major landowner on the Central Coast, participating in formal joint management of some areas of state forest in the region.

The Darkinjung Local Aboriginal Land Council are self-appointed caretakers of the Central Coast of NSW Australia.

[1] The Darkinjung people are believed to have died out in the late 19th century due to the effects of disease and dispossession.

In the 2012–13 financial year, $2.2 million was incurred on capital acquisition.

A further sum was spent on consultants related to the land development.
